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-98,7 +98,7 @@ VERILATOR_ARGS += --x-assign fast --x-initial fast
VERILATOR_CFLAGS += -O3 -march=native -mtune=native

verilator/croc.f: Bender.lock Bender.yml
$(BENDER) script verilator -t rtl -t verilator -DSYNTHESIS -DVERILATOR > $@
$(BENDER) script verilator -t rtl -t verilator -t cve2_include_tracer -DSYNTHESIS -DVERILATOR -DTRACE_EXECUTION > $@

verilator/obj_dir/Vtb_croc_soc: verilator/croc.f $(SW_HEX)
cd verilator; $(VERILATOR) $(VERILATOR_ARGS) -O3 --top tb_croc_soc -f croc.f
Expand Down
24 changes: 24 additions & 0 deletions rtl/.patches/cve2/rtl/0007-remove-extra-input-assignment.patch
Original file line number Diff line number Diff line change
@@ -0,0 +1,24 @@
From 82fec88c88e2648db731e60e543827222701f05b Mon Sep 17 00:00:00 2001
From: Enrico Zelioli <ezelioli@iis.ee.ethz.ch>
Date: Mon, 22 Dec 2025 18:23:56 +0100
Subject: [PATCH] remove extra input assignment

---
cve2_core_tracing.sv | 1 -
1 file changed, 1 deletion(-)

diff --git a/cve2_core_tracing.sv b/cve2_core_tracing.sv
index efc157c0..f4a124de 100644
--- a/cve2_core_tracing.sv
+++ b/cve2_core_tracing.sv
@@ -150,7 +150,6 @@ module cve2_core_tracing import cve2_pkg::*; #(
.rst_ni,

.test_en_i,
- .ram_cfg_i,

.hart_id_i,
.boot_addr_i,
--
2.43.5

1 change: 0 additions & 1 deletion rtl/cve2/cve2_core_tracing.sv
Original file line number Diff line number Diff line change
Expand Up @@ -150,7 +150,6 @@ module cve2_core_tracing import cve2_pkg::*; #(
.rst_ni,

.test_en_i,
.ram_cfg_i,

.hart_id_i,
.boot_addr_i,
Expand Down